Disney and WEBTOON Forge Alliance to Reimagine Iconic Comics for Mobile Readers

A groundbreaking partnership between WEBTOON Entertainment and Disney will bring approximately 100 beloved comic titles from Disney, Marvel, 20th Century Studios, and Star Wars to WEBTOON’s popular vertical-scroll platform, expanding access to these stories for a new generation of fans.

WEBTOON has rapidly become a dominant force in the digital comics landscape,and this collaboration represents a significant expansion of its content library. The move underscores a broader trend of established entertainment giants embracing the mobile-first format that has become synonymous with WEBTOON’s success. This isn’t WEBTOON’s first foray into partnerships with major comic publishers; the platform has already collaborated with DC Comics and Dark Horse, demonstrating its growing influence within the industry.

Did you know? – WEBTOON originated in South Korea in 2004 as Naver Webtoon. It quickly became the most popular webcomic platform in the country before expanding globally.

Expanding Universes on a Digital Canvas

The collaboration extends beyond simply reformating existing comics for a mobile experience. According to a company release, original webcomic series based on Disney, Marvel, 20th century Studios, and Star Wars intellectual property are also in progress. These new stories promise to deliver “fresh adventures” for fan-favorite characters, specifically designed for the unique reading experience offered by WEBTOON.

This strategic move allows disney to tap into WEBTOON’s established audience and distribution network, while simultaneously offering a new avenue for creative storytelling. “Partnering with WEBTOON allows us to expand our universes on a top-tier digital platform, reaching a dedicated global audience while inviting new fans to experience Disney storytelling in an exciting, lasting way,” stated a senior official from disney consumer Products.

Launch Titles and Access Options

At launch, readers will have access to free episodes of several popular series, including Amazing Spider-Man (2022-present), Avengers (2012), Star Wars (2015), Alien (2021), and Disney As Old As Time: A Twisted Tale. Additional episodes will be available for purchase using WEBTOON Coins,the platform’s virtual currency.

This tiered access model allows WEBTOON to offer a taste of the content to a broad audience while also generating revenue through continued engagement. The availability of these titles worldwide within the English-language app ensures a global reach for Disney’s iconic stories.

Pro tip: – WEBTOON utilizes a “fast pass” system. Readers can use coins to unlock episodes immediately instead of waiting for free releases.

A New Generation of Comic Fans

WEBTOON’s Chief Strategy Officer and Head of Global WEBTOON, Yongsoo Kim, emphasized the long-term vision for the partnership. “This is just the start,” Kim said. “We’re introducing legendary storytelling to a new generation of mobile-native comic fans while giving longtime readers a fresh way to enjoy their favorite series.”

This sentiment highlights the core strategy behind the collaboration: to bridge the gap between traditional comic book fandom and the rapidly growing world of digital webcomics.
